I have refractometer and a chart to convert Brix to SG...but

does either tell me what is the sugar content of the liquid?

I mean how do I know if the liquid is say 10% sugar?

:confused:
 
You answered your own question. ;)

1 brix is 1 gram of sucrose in 100 g water. Or 1% sucrose by weight.

10 brix = 10% sucrose, by weight
